Brooklynn Kascel makes visual stories that intersect gender, queerness, intimacy, and relationship narratives in the family unit. She applies documentary, editorial, self-portraiture and archival approaches to pursue these evolving themes in response to social, economic and environmental concerns.
Brooklynn grew up in Marion, Iowa and graduated from the University of Iowa with BFA degrees in Journalism and Mass Communications and Sociology. Upon graduation, she worked as an assistant for Danny Wilcox Frazier of VII Photo. Kascel has published work with American Reportage, Dagens Nyheter, L’ Express Magazine, New York Times, Twin Cities Pride Magazine and BURN Magazine. Kascel has shown in exhibitions and online at Open Show San Diego, Kolga Tbilisi Photo, Spazio Labo and Midwest Center for Photography among others.
